💬What is Knife Dash?
The premise is dead simple: stuff spins in front of you—apples, watermelons, an entire pepperoni pizza—and you hurl knives until it splits. Depending on the object, you'll need a handful or a dozen blades. Each hit earns coins. Those coins go straight into upgrades. Sharper edges, faster throws, more blades per second. It's not about aiming; it's about finding the fastest way to make fruit explode. That's where it gets weirdly addictive. I thought I'd play for two minutes, then I looked up and had maxed three upgrades and wasn't stopping.
Once you've sliced through enough pineapples, you can reset your progress for a multiplier and start the whole beautiful mess over again. The idle part means it keeps earning while you're gone, but the real fun is staying to watch the numbers climb. A pineapple taking fifteen knives before it splits feels like a tiny boss fight, and the moment it finally bursts, the coin shower makes it worth it.
Visually it's clean and juicy—each fruit splits into clean wedges and the knife sticks with a little thunk. It runs on anything with a browser, no downloads. If you like idle games that don't bury you in menus, this one's a solid time eater.

✨Game Tips
Upgrade throwing speed before damage — more knives hitting per second makes early levels fly.
Don't hoard coins waiting for the perfect upgrade; buying the first three cheap tiers speeds up progress dramatically.
Watch for the upgrade that boosts coin earnings — it's the real snowball trigger for prestige runs.
Leave the game running in a background tab if you can; idle income stacks up quietly.
When a new fruit type appears with much higher health, focus on damage per knife instead of just more knives.
